Visa Lighting's new suspension system Power Art Cable(TM) and Building Information Modeling program are accepted into the prestigious 2008 Illuminating Engineering Society of North America (IESNA) Progress Report. IESNA Progress Report is limited to products exhibiting significant progress in the art and science of lighting. Visa Lighting's PAC(TM) and Building Information Models were presented at the IESNA Annual Conference, November 10 in Savannah, Georgia, posted on the IESNA Web site and appear in the January 2009 issue of LD+A."The Progress Committee's mission is to keep in touch with developements in the art and science of lighting throughout the world and prepare a yearly report of achievements for the Society. Acceptance into the Progress Report is based on an impartial judging process used by the committe to evaluate each submission on it's uniqueness, innovation and significance to the lighting industry."Building Information Modeling files are available in Revit, Bentley and SketchUp.
